Job description

Are you passionate about the intricacies of the criminal justice system and eager to shape the minds of future law enforcement professionals? As a Criminal Justice Instructor, you will play a pivotal role in educating and inspiring students about various aspects of the criminal justice field, including law enforcement, corrections, criminology, and legal studies. South Carolina State University's ideal candidate is a dedicated individual with a blend of academic expertise, real-world experience, and a commitment to fostering a dynamic and engaging learning environment. This role requires not only a deep understanding of criminal justice theories and practices but also the ability to translate complex concepts into accessible lessons. SC State is hiring now for an Instructor of Criminal Justice.

Duties And Responsibilities
  • Develop and deliver lectures and coursework on various criminal justice topics.
  • Design, develop, implement, and revise courses, curricula, and academic programs that support program objectives that align with departmental, college, and university goals.
  • Stay up to date with the latest trends and developments in the field of criminal justice.
  • Prepare and grade assignments, exams, and projects.
  • Provide mentorship and academic advising to students.
  • Facilitate classroom discussions and encourage student participation.
  • Conduct and publish research in the field of criminal justice.
  • Collaborate with colleagues to enhance the quality of the educational program.
  • Participate in faculty meetings, committees, and professional development activities (university, college and departmental).
  • Maintain accurate records of student performance and progress.
Minimum Requirements For Entry Into Position
  • Master's degree in criminal justice or a closely related field.
  • Professional experience in the criminal justice system.
Preferred Requirements For Entry Into Position
  • Ph.D. in Criminal Justice or a related field.
  • Experience in law enforcement or criminal justice research.
  • Prior teaching experience at the college or university level.
